The diagnosis and treatment planning module emphasises the philosophy of total oral healthcare for patients. Candidates are challenged to consider not only the diagnostic tools they use every day and why they use them but their decision-making process and how that is communicated to patients and other healthcare professionals.

Learning outcomes

The ability to perform appropriate investigative examination procedures and special investigations and integrate these findings into a structured and prioritised treatment plan with multiple options presented which consider patient centred care.

A/Prof John Boucher AM BDSc LDS FRACDS FICD FPFA GAICD

A/Prof John Boucher graduated from the University of Melbourne in 1978 as First in Graduating Class with First Class Honours. A/Prof Boucher has had a career long involvement in dental education and assessment, having completed over 40 years teaching and examining at the Melbourne Dental School, University of Melbourne. A/Prof Boucher is a Past President of the Dental Practice Board of Victoria and the Victorian Committee of the Dental Board of Australia. A/Prof Boucher is a Past President of the Australian Dental Council having been an examiner for the past 28 years. A/Prof Boucher is a practising general dentist and an examiner for RACDS. In June 2019 A/Prof Boucher was recognised with the award of a Member of the Order of Australia.
